thinkphp图片上传到后台

thinkphp图片上传到后台

1. 前端页面准备:首先需要在前端页面中添加一个表单,包含一个文件上传框和一个提交按钮。文件上传框需要设置为type="file",并且需要设置name属性,以便在后台获取上传的文件。

2. 后台接收文件:当用户点击提交按钮时,前端页面会向后台发送一个POST请求,请求中包含上传的文件。后台需要接收这个请求,并且获取上传的文件。可以使用$_FILES来获取上传的文件信息。

3. 文件处理:接收到文件后,需要对文件进行处理。可以先判断文件类型是否允许上传,如果允许上传,则需要将文件保存到指定的目录中。可以使用move_uploaded_file函数来将文件从临时目录移动到指定目录中。

4. 数据库存储:如果需要将上传的文件存储到数据库中,可以将文件的相关信息存储到数据库表中,例如文件名、文件路径、上传时间等。

5. 响应结果:最后,需要向前端页面返回一个响应结果,表示文件上传是否成功。可以使用json_encode函数将结果编码为JSON格式,然后通过echo输出到前端页面。

总之,实现图片上传到后台需要前后端的配合,前端需要准备好上传文件的表单,后台需要接收并处理上传的文件,并将结果返回给前端。

  • 免责声明:本文仅代表文章作者的个人观点,与本站无关。其原创性、真实性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容文字的真实性、完整性和原创性本站不作任何保证或承诺,请读者仅作参考,并自行核实相关内容。[版权声明] 本站所有文章由用户发布,若内容存在侵权,请联系网站客服处理。
请先 登录 后评论
  • 26 关注
  • 0 收藏,29 浏览
  • 遥望
    发布于 2023-10-15 01:18:15
站长微信
微信号: yunentropykeji
官网制作、商城开发、小程序开发
微信沟通